[Skiboot] [PATCH 1/2] opal/hmi: Fix TB reside and HDEC parity error recovery for power9

Stewart Smith stewart at linux.vnet.ibm.com
Tue Oct 24 07:44:43 AEDT 2017


Mahesh J Salgaonkar <mahesh at linux.vnet.ibm.com> writes:
> From: Mahesh Salgaonkar <mahesh at linux.vnet.ibm.com>
>
> On TB/HDEC errors, all 4 threads on the affected receives HMI. On power9,
> every thread on the core has its own copy of TB/HDEC and hence every thread
> has to clear the dirty data from its own TB/HDEC register before we clear tb
> errors through TFMR[24]. The HMI recovery would fail even if one thread
> do not cleanup the respective TB/HDEC register.
>
> Signed-off-by: Mahesh Salgaonkar <mahesh at linux.vnet.ibm.com>
> ---
>  core/hmi.c |  105
> 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++--

Thanks, series merged to master as of 00f2540c3c69c922771a73fda2ef83f49aaee0b6

-- 
Stewart Smith
OPAL Architect, IBM.



More information about the Skiboot mailing list